WHEN ONE INCREASES THE OTHER MUST DECREASE. THIS IS BECAUSE THE WORK OUTPUT IS NEVER GREATER THAN THE WORK INPUT. ... MECHANICAL EFFICIENCY=WORK OUTPUT/WORK INPUT X 100 Page 2 NO MACHINE IS 100 PERCENT EFFICIENCY, BUT REDUCING THE AMOUNT OF FRICTION IN A MACHINE IS A WAY TO INCREASE ITS MECHANICAL EFFICIENCY
